.wysiwyg-section{padding-top:5rem;padding-bottom:5rem}@media (max-width:48rem){.wysiwyg-section{padding-top:2.5rem;padding-bottom:2.5rem}}.wysiwyg-section .wysiwyg-wrapper{-webkit-overflow-scrolling:touch;width:100%;min-width:0;max-width:100%;overflow:auto hidden}.wysiwyg-section .wysiwyg-wrapper table{table-layout:fixed;width:100%!important;min-width:0!important;max-width:100%!important;margin-left:0!important;margin-right:0!important}.wysiwyg-section .wysiwyg-wrapper table th,.wysiwyg-section .wysiwyg-wrapper table td{overflow-wrap:anywhere;word-break:break-word;white-space:normal!important}.wysiwyg-section .wysiwyg-wrapper table img,.wysiwyg-section .wysiwyg-wrapper table iframe,.wysiwyg-section .wysiwyg-wrapper table svg{max-width:100%;height:auto}.wysiwyg-section__lead-image{aspect-ratio:3/4;width:100%;max-width:11.25rem;margin:0 auto 5rem;position:relative;overflow:hidden;box-shadow:0 4px 6px -1px #0000001a,0 2px 4px -1px #0000000f}.wysiwyg-section__lead-image .merlin-image{width:100%;height:100%;display:block}.wysiwyg-section__lead-image .merlin-image--background,.wysiwyg-section__lead-image img{object-fit:cover;object-position:center;width:100%;height:100%;display:block}@media (max-width:48rem){.wysiwyg-section__lead-image{max-width:7.5rem;margin-bottom:2.5rem}}.wysiwyg-section__header{text-align:center;flex-direction:column;justify-content:center;align-items:center;margin:0 auto 5rem;display:flex}@media (max-width:48rem){.wysiwyg-section__header{margin-bottom:2.5rem}}.wysiwyg-section__title{color:#073050;font-family:Merriweather,serif;font-size:3.75rem;font-weight:700;line-height:1.2}@media (max-width:48rem){.wysiwyg-section__title{font-size:2.5rem}}.wysiwyg-section__title{margin:0}.wysiwyg-section__subtitle{color:#111928;font-family:Inter,sans-serif;font-size:1rem;font-weight:400;line-height:1.5}@media (max-width:48rem){.wysiwyg-section__subtitle{font-size:.875rem}}.wysiwyg-section__subtitle{color:#111928;max-width:45rem;margin-top:1rem}.wysiwyg-section__subtitle p{margin:0}.wysiwyg-section__list{flex-direction:column;gap:1rem;max-width:45rem;margin:0 auto;display:flex}.wysiwyg-section__list>*{min-width:0}.wysiwyg-section__card{background-color:#fff;min-width:0;padding:5rem 2.5rem;box-shadow:0 4px 6px -1px #0000001a,0 2px 4px -1px #0000000f}.wysiwyg-section__event-info{flex-direction:column;gap:.25rem;margin-bottom:2.5rem;display:flex}.wysiwyg-section__event-row .icon{width:1rem;height:1rem}@media (max-width:48rem){.wysiwyg-section__card{padding:1.5rem 1rem}}
